The Core Functions of Fund Administration
Fund administration encompasses a range of back-office services that are essential for the day-to-day operation of investment funds. These services include accounting, investor services, regulatory and compliance, reporting, and valuation. By managing these comprehensive tasks, fund administrators help in navigating the complexities of financial regulations and in maintaining investor trust through transparency and precision.
Streamlining Fund Accounting
Accuracy in fund accounting is necessary to the integrity of an investment fund. Administrators are responsible for meticulous financial record-keeping, ensuring all transactions are recorded accurately and in compliance with industry standards. This process includes net asset value (NAV) calculation, fee processing, and distribution management, which are central to the accurate valuation of a fund.
Investor Services
Providing excellent investor services involves managing communications with investors, processing subscriptions and redemptions, and maintaining investor records. By outsourcing these tasks, fund managers can offer seamless service to their investors, reinforcing confidence and ensuring compliance with regulatory requirements.

Valuation Services
Fund valuation services involve the accurate assessment of the fund’s assets and liabilities, which is key to determining the overall value of the fund. Professional valuation services ensure that asset pricing reflects the most current market data, maintaining the integrity of financial reporting and decision-making processes.
